Abstract Tree diversity declines and shifts in mycorrhizal dominance may have cascading effects on multitrophic diversity. Whether the effects are additive or synergistic and consistent across taxa and functional groups is unclear. Here we test how microorganisms and invertebrates spanning multiple trophic levels, both above- and belowground, respond to experimental manipulation of tree species richness and mycorrhizal type in a young forest stand (the MyDiv experiment in Germany). Tree diversity increased belowground abundance and taxonomic richness of microorganisms and lower-trophic-level nematodes, cascading to meso- and macrofauna predators, whereas aboveground effects were limited to foliar fungi and soil-surface omnivores. Mycorrhizal type strongly structured belowground food webs and influenced aboveground predators, but mixtures showed only additive effects. For most trophic groups, diversity responses were similar across mycorrhizal types. Tree diversity and mycorrhizal type effects were mediated by leaf quality, canopy complexity and nutrient availability. Our results highlight tree diversity and mycorrhizal type as potentially distinct drivers of multitrophic biodiversity, primarily governing belowground bottom-up effects.
